I can no longer supply tools for adjusting and regulating clavichords; however, I have left this page live in case it inspires others to make their own similar tools, or even to produce them once again for sale.
Cloth strips for muting alternate strings when tuning (thick, medium, or thin) | Wooden wedges for putting in cloth strips when tuning (boxwood or ebony) | Felt wedges, for muting one string of a pair while tuning | Bulldog® clips, for securing loops to hitchpins while fitting strings | Stringing tool, for producing a tight coil to grip tuning pins. | Pin-adjusting tool, for changing the angle of balance and guide pins | Threading hook (line-baiting hook), for threading wires through listing | Listing hook, for putting in or adjusting woven listing |
